Transaction 2997609433111d0a65a881ce2a3b81e98f0d8c5290d22145709583c32a9d4b44
1 Input
1 Output
-
2997609433111d0a65a881ce2a3b81e98f0d8c5290d22145709583c32a9d4b44:0
- value
- 12897586
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0726117e1c8c50b19b7aad331fecea1b49c6253c OP_EQUALVERIFY OP_CHECKSIG
- address
- LKskbbAMUYmXRvFzRoP1U2UqAKgj1qPSuJ